WATCH LIVE: Trump takes part in Oval Office maternal healthcare event

On Monday, President Donald Trump is scheduled to participate in a maternal healthcare event at 10:30 a.m. in the Oval Office. The event is likely centered on Moms.gov, a website launched by the Trump administration on Mother’s day to provide resources for expecting women and their families. Health and Human Services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r.said the site is part of the “Make America Healthy Again” initiative, aimed at supporting parents dealing with difficult or unexpected pregnancies and promoting the wellbeing and health of American families.
